Hermann was born in Wangen, Switzerland on April 30th, 1937. He was the second of five children born to Hermann and Agnes Müller and grew up on a family farm in Kaltbrunn during the hard years of the second world war.
After completing his schooling he pursued a career as a butcher, which he practiced with great passion throughout his life. While employed in the Swiss Mountains of Grisons he met Margrit Ragettli, whom he married in 1961. They were blessed with five children; Manuela, Karin, Corina, Martin and Jürg. Together they successfully ran their own butcher shop for 20 years in Schmerikon, Switzerland. In 1984, they fulfilled their dream of immigrating to Canada and moved to Swan River, Manitoba with their family. Hermann joined Valley Meat Packers as a partner of the late Peter Schellenbaum, and in 1987, he became the sole owner of the business. He had a gift for running a successful business and managed the plant with commitment, hard work, and dedication, serving the valley until 2003, when his children Corina, Martin, and Jürg purchased the business. Even though he was retired, you could still find him working at the abattoir every day.
Hermann had two homes - Switzerland and Canada, where he was admired by many. He loved a good handshake, cup of coffee, cigar and great conversation. Hermann enjoyed playing cards, pingpong and foosball. He was a singer, traveller and storyteller and he cherished his time with family and friends.
